Best Oakland Raiders quarterback of all time

One of the most popular football teams in the history of the National Football League is the Oakland Raiders. While it’s true that the Raiders have been through some tough times lately, they continue to have tons of fans from all corners of the country. When it comes to popularity and the sport of football, few players are more popular than the quarterback. So who then is the best quarterback the Oakland Raiders have ever had?

When analyzing who is the best in any category, a great deal of subjectivity comes into play. Is the best quarterback the one who has brought the team the most championships? Is the best quarterback the one who has thrown more touchdowns than anyone else in team history? Or is the best quarterback the one who has held the starting position the longest?

Jim Plunkett went undrafted by the Raiders and flopped a bit as a starter for the New England Patriots and then the San Francisco 49ers before coming to Oakland in the late 1970s and leading the team to two Super Bowl wins.

Rich Gannon only played for the Raiders for six seasons, but in that time he threw for the second-most yards in team history with a total of 17,585. That’s an average of more than 2,900 yards per season. Gannon actually only started at quarterback for the Raiders for four full seasons and in those years he threw for 15,787 yards, which is an average of just under 4,000 yards per year. In addition to this, he also averaged almost twenty touchdowns per season and made the pro bowl four times, and was named the NFL MVP in 2002.

Only one player has thrown for more touchdowns in an Oakland Raiders uniform than Daryle Lamonica. Lamonica was the Raiders’ first big-name quarterback and is still held in high regard. As the starting quarterback, Lamonica’s record was 62-16-6. He twice led the AFL in touchdown passes and once led the league in passing yards. Daryle Lamonica would go on to be named UPI Player of the Year twice, first in 1967 and then again two years later in 1969.

However, the best quarterback in Oakland Raiders history is also one of the most popular players in team history. Ken Stabler has thrown for more yards and touchdowns than any other Oakland Raiders player in history. Nicknamed “The Serpent” for his ability to fight and avoid capture, Stabler would play for the Raiders for ten seasons, seven of them as the main starting quarterback. He would lead the league in touchdown passes twice, be named the 1974 NFL MVP, play in four Pro Bowls and lead the Raiders to a Super Bowl victory after the 1976 NFL season.
